📄 rcs-materials.rb
字号:
# # materials.rb -- create custom materials for simspark##----------------------------------------------------------------# special purpose materials#----------------------------------------------------------------# ballmaterial =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matBall');material.setDiffuse(1.0,0.3,0.0,1.0)material.setAmbient(0.2,0.06,0.0,1.0)# running track around the fieldmaterial =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matTrack');material.setDiffuse(1.0,0.64,0.4,1.0)material.setAmbient(0.2,0.01,0.0,1.0)# grassmaterial =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matGrass');material.setDiffuse(0.1,0.6,0.1,1.0)material.setAmbient(0.1,0.3,0.1,1.0)#----------------------------------------------------------------# left team#----------------------------------------------------------------# jersey color for left teammaterial =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)# material with unumsmaterial =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ft1');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ft2');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ft3');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ft4');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ft5');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ft6');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ft7');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ft8');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ft9');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ft10');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matLeft11');material.setDiffuse(0.0,0.75,1.0,1.0)material.setAmbient(0.0,0.2,0.15,1.0)#----------------------------------------------------------------# right team#----------------------------------------------------------------# jersey color for right teammaterial =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)# material with unumsmaterial =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ight1');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ight2');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ight3');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ight4');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ight5');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ight6');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ight7');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ight8');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ight9');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ight10');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)material = sparkCreate('kerosin/MaterialSolid', $serverPath+'material/matRight11');material.setDiffuse(1.0,0.0,0.75,1.0)material.setAmbient(0.2,0.0,0.15,1.0)
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-